I did a clean install of Umbraco v7 using WebMatrix and selected SQL Server and then installed SQL Backup package and get following error, any ideas?
Could not load control: '/UserControls/SQLBackUp/SQLBackUp.ascx'. Error message: System.Web.HttpException (0x80004005): The file '/UserControls/SQLBackUp/SQLBackUp.ascx' does not exist. at System.Web.UI.Util.CheckVirtualFileExists(VirtualPath virtualPath) at System.Web.Compilation.BuildManager.GetVPathBuildResultInternal(VirtualPath virtualPath, Boolean noBuild, Boolean allowCrossApp, Boolean allowBuildInPrecompile, Boolean throwIfNotFound, Boolean ensureIsUpToDate) at System.Web.Compilation.BuildManager.GetVPathBuildResultWithNoAssert(HttpContext context, VirtualPath virtualPath, Boolean noBuild, Boolean allowCrossApp, Boolean allowBuildInPrecompile, Boolean throwIfNotFound, Boolean ensureIsUpToDate) at System.Web.UI.TemplateControl.LoadControl(VirtualPath virtualPath) at Umbraco.Web.UI.Umbraco.Dashboard.UserControlProxy.OnInit(EventArgs e)
